
CoCo-70X Vibration Analyzer
The CoCo-70X is Crystal Instruments’ latest handheld vibration analyzer, featuring an improved user interface and redesigned chassis.
The CoCo-70X is a four-channel vibration analyzer with an IP-67 rating, designed specifically for the machinery Predictive Maintenance (PdM) community.
The CoCo-70X offers powerful processing capabilities and an intuitive user-interface, providing users with an easy-to-use data collection experience.
The newly designed chassis is lighter and more ruggedized, making the CoCo-70X a perfect device for route-based measurements.
Description
Waterproof
Crystal Instruments has improved the CoCo’s protection against water compared to the previous model. The new CoCo-70X can withstand up to 1 meter of water for a maximum of 30 minutes.

CoCo-80X Vibration Data Collector
The CoCo-80X operates in either Dynamic Signal Analysis (DSA) or Vibration Data Collector (VDC) mode. Each working mode has its own user interface and navigation structure. VDC mode is dedicated to machine vibration data collection, analysis, and trending. It provides both route based data collection and onsite measurement functions.
The route based data collection mode includes: overall readings, time waveform, spectrum and demodulated spectrum. Onsite measurement mode conducts following test in additional to the data collection functions: bump test, coast-down/ run-up, and balancing.
Crystal Instruments’ data collection system consists of the portable CoCo-80X data collector and the Engineering Data Management (EDM) software, designed specifically for use in industrial and manufacturing plants to acquire, analyze, and maintain data related to improving and optimizing the reliability and performance of rotating machinery.
Description
ROUTE BASED CONDITION MONITORING
Measurement Channels: 1 or 3 channels (tri-axis) with tachometer enabled or disabled Route Collection control: Easy navigation from the UI level to routes. View or hold live signals, review measured record, previous measurement entry, next measurement entry, previous point, next point, point and route management.
DEMODULATED SPECTRUM
Available in both route collection and onsite mode Demodulation Bandwidth: 24 bandwidth options ranging from 125 Hz – 1.44 kHz, to 32 kHz – 46.08 kHz.
COAST-DOWN/RUN-UP
The following measurements can be made in the Order Tracking option: Raw time streams, real-time order tracks and order spectra, narrow band RPM spectra and fixed band RPM spectra, overall RPM spectrum, and order tracks with phase relative to tachometer signals.
ROTOR BALANCING
Enables users to correct the imbalance without dismantling the machine. It is possible to balance rotors of any size with either 1 or 2 place balancing. Using the multiple channel option, parallel measurements on 2 sensors are possible, resulting in a faster, safer, and more accurate procedure. The user interface allows stopping and starting balancing as needed and to repeat any single operation without running the whole procedure.

Spider-20 Dynamic Signal Analyzer & Data Recorder
Spider-20 is a compact yet powerful dynamic signal analyzer and digital data recorder. It provides four 24-bit precise high-fidelity input channels, and a unique software-selectable tachometer-input/signal-source output channel (all using conventional BNC connectors). Each input is individually programmable to accept AC or DC voltage or output from an IEPE (ICP) sensor with built-in electronics.
Description
Spider-20 is a diminutive 5.3 x 4.3 x 1 inch tool weighing only 18 ounces. It has only three push-button controls and five LED status indicators. This little powerhouse can run over 6 hours on its internal rechargeable battery which can be replaced in field with a backup battery. It can also record data on its built-in 4GB flash memory at the simple push of a button.
Spider-20 communicates with the world through its built-in Wi-Fi interface. Use your iPad to setup and view or record time histories as well as perform spectrum analysis or measure Frequency Response and Coherence functions. Link the Spider-20 to your laptop or tablet running Windows and enjoy the full repertoire of functionality provided by our EDM (Engineering Data Management) software including 1/nth Octave acoustic functions, Order Tracking for rotating machinery, Shock Response Spectra for drop testing, or Digital Filtering for special purpose analysis.
A secondary version, Spider-20E, replaces Wi-Fi with a wired Ethernet connection. The device has the same form factor as the standard wireless version.
Transfer measured data to truly massive storage space using the EDM Cloud server. EDM can be used to program your Spider-20 to perform a custom measurement or measurement sequence at the touch of its START button, making it an unintimidating and user-friendly tool. No computer, tablet or phone is required; just use your thumb and your Spider-20 operating in Black Box mode. Use our flexible Automated Schedule and Limiting software to turn this Spider into an intelligent unattended monitor capable of responding to data conditions or networked instructions, notifying you of significant conditions via e-mail.

Spider-80X Machine Condition Monitoring System
The compact Spider-80X is designed for machine condition monitoring.
Each front-end features eight analog input channels and two channels that may be software selected as tachometer inputs for the analysis of rotating machinery.
The Spider-80X inputs provides absolute/differential and AC/DC/IEPE coupling choices; charge mode is an available option. The Spider-80X provides the same IEEE 1588 time sync Ethernet connectivity available on all Crystal Instruments Spider products and 4 GB flash memory for data and program storage.
Multiple Spider-80X front-ends may be linked together using the (eight-into-one) Spider-HUB module and storage can be increased to 250 GB by adding a Spider-NAS mass storage module. Up to 128 channels can be configured in a Spider-80X system.
Description
Cloud Based Remote Monitoring
EDM Cloud combined with the Spider-80X system is the ideal choice for machine condition monitoring. With EDM Cloud, the test and the test engineer can literally be oceans apart. Any of the usual EDM tests can be incorporated into a test suite, fully developed in the comfort of the office, and then sent to the Spider front-ends far away. Check measurements against a variety of criteria; tests run locally, on the Spiders. Results are available across the world, in real-time. EDM Cloud is server-based software designed to take vibration and other measurements remotely using Spider front-ends. Applications include machine conditioning monitoring, wind turbine vibration and status monitoring, bridge and railway vibration monitoring, tunnel sound monitoring and more. By opening a web browser on a tablet PC, iPad, PC or a smart phone, the user can access real time or historical data instantly.
